The Importance of Table Image: Mucking and Player Perception

Being deliberate and selective about when you show your cards can give you an edge

In poker, every decision at the table sends a message, and how you handle mucked hands is no exception. Your table image—the way opponents perceive your playing style—directly influences how they respond to your bets, calls, and raises. Mucking might seem like a small detail, but it can play a subtle role in shaping this image over the course of a session.

When a player mucks their hand, the table is left guessing what cards were held. That mystery can work in your favor. If you’ve been caught bluffing earlier, consistent mucking might make opponents wonder if you’re hiding more weak hands.

On the other hand, if you’ve been showing down strong holdings and suddenly muck a winner, it can help disguise your range and leave others uncertain about how to approach future pots against you. This uncertainty is often more valuable than showing the truth.

Players also notice patterns. If you always muck after failed bluffs, sharp opponents will catch on and pressure you more often. Conversely, mucking winning hands too frequently can rob you of opportunities to reinforce a strong, tight image that might earn you more respect. The balance lies in sometimes letting opponents see strength at showdown while other times maintaining that air of mystery by sliding your cards quietly into the muck.

Another layer to consider is emotional control. Careless mucking, especially when done with frustration, signals tilt and can embolden aggressive players to target you. Calmly releasing your cards, whether you’re folding trash or a monster that never connected, helps maintain composure and projects steadiness.
